Finding the sweet notes
Finding the sweet notes In video lesson 24 of Learn Jazz Piano I focus on how songwriters employ ‘sweet notes’ to add that spine tingling effect to their melody. I then relate this to jazz improvisation and show you how to employ this technique in your solos. Here’s an extract from chapter 10 of my eBook… Read more »
